今天分析另外一个零代码、低代码产品-简道云,跟所有低代码产品的架构图一样,高、大、炫、美。 依然是从下至上,从左到右的顺序。 开发层 搭建中心 表单、流程、报表、用户中心,还是这些内容,自定义打印很多平台都有&am…
2025/1/28 12:56:50之前笔者写过一篇博文ubuntu使用LLVM官方发布的tar.xz来安装Clang编译器介绍了Ubuntu下使用官方发布的tar.xz包来安装Clang编译。官方发布的版本中也有MacOS版本的tar.xz,那MacOS应该也是可以安装的。 笔者2015款MBP笔记本,CPU是intel的,出厂…
2025/1/26 15:15:37[精确算法] 高斯消元法求线性方程组 线性方程组 考虑线性方程组, 已知 A ∈ R n , n , b ∈ R n A\in \mathbb{R}^{n,n},b\in \mathbb{R}^n A∈Rn,n,b∈Rn, 求未知 x ∈ R n x\in \mathbb{R}^n x∈Rn A 1 , 1 x 1 A 1 , 2 x 2 ⋯ A 1 , n x n b 1…
2025/1/26 0:52:461、算术运算符 加 减— 乘* 除/ 整除// 取余% 幂运算** 优先级: 第1级:** 第2级:* , / , % ,// 第3级; , - print("加", 1 4) print("减",8 - 19) p…
2025/1/25 8:01:02php中1)编码$jsonStr json_encode($array)2)解码$arr json_decode($jsonStr)echo json_encode("中文", JSON_UNESCAPED_UNICODE);添加参数:JSON_UNESCAPED_UNICODE即可。测试环境:PHP Version 5.5.36js中1. 编码var str obj.toJSONString()…
2025/1/30 22:35:27 人评论 次浏览对于高并发的系统,所有的请求都打在数据库上是不明智的选择。一般的做法是通过缓存来缓解数据库的压力。缓存是用于解决高并发场景下系统的性能及稳定性问题的银弹。最主要的就是要考虑到缓存的穿透性和数据一致性问题。 先来看一个示例: 这是一个简单应…
2025/1/30 20:04:41 人评论 次浏览在数据结构中会看到: typedef struct QNode{ QElemType data; //数据域 struct QNode *next; //指针域 }QNode,*QueuePtr;typedef struct{QueuePtr front; //队头指针QueuePtr rear; //队尾指针 };关键在于后面的那个部分如何理解 就是QNode,*QueuePtr这两个如何理…
2025/1/30 19:55:33 人评论 次浏览去年自己写过一个程序时,不太确定自己的内存使用量,就想找写工具来打印程序或函数的内存使用量。这里将上次找到的2个内存检测工具的基本用法记录一下,今后分析Python程序内存使用量时也是需要的。memory_profiler模块(与psutil一起使用)注&a…
2025/1/30 22:35:58 人评论 次浏览php中1)编码$jsonStr json_encode($array)2)解码$arr json_decode($jsonStr)echo json_encode("中文", JSON_UNESCAPED_UNICODE);添加参数:JSON_UNESCAPED_UNICODE即可。测试环境:PHP Version 5.5.36js中1. 编码var str obj.toJSONString()…
2025/1/30 22:35:27 人评论 次浏览**一.解决图片底部3个像素问题** 原因:底部多余的为图片3像素。是由图片元素默认为inline-block引起的。 方法: 1,给img图片标签添加属性vertical-align:top;(不是baseline即可)2,img的父标签添加属性&…
2025/1/30 22:34:57 人评论 次浏览目前对于硬盘的分区方式有两种:MBR和GPT。本文只是为了介绍分区中的MBR的备份和恢复,所以不对GPT分区做过多的介绍。我们先来对MBR的分区方式进行一个简单的介绍:上图说明:采用MBR分区的硬盘中一共有四个分区:扩展分区…
2025/1/30 22:34:27 人评论 次浏览转载自:https://blog.csdn.net/dcrmg/article/details/53912941 C11中引入了一个用于多线程操作的thread类,简单多线程示例: #include <iostream> #include <thread> #include <Windows.h> using namespace std; vo…
2025/1/30 22:33:56 人评论 次浏览这里是修真院后端小课堂,每篇分享文从 【背景介绍】【知识剖析】【常见问题】【解决方案】【编码实战】【扩展思考】【更多讨论】【参考文献】 八个方面深度解析后端知识/技能,本篇分享的是: 【 Maven常用的四个命令】 大家好,…
2025/1/30 22:33:25 人评论 次浏览三种方法: 1)str.replace(/oldstring/g,newstring); 2)str.replace(new RegExp(newstring,"gm"),newstring); 3)增加string原型方法replaceAll。 前两种里面都是正则表达式实现的,其中: g …
2025/1/29 22:39:30 人评论 次浏览以下是linux主机下的虚拟机联网方式(记录一下) :1、首先选择的是第三种NAT连接方式(还有其他两种Host-only连接方式,Bridge(桥接)连接方式)设置本地连接,共享VMnet8模式&…
2025/1/29 22:38:59 人评论 次浏览1、v-table; class 2、WitnessTable protocol 3、消息派发。 objc dynamic
2025/1/29 22:38:29 人评论 次浏览一,shell调用python 1,shell直接调用python shell调用python是比较简单的,直接在.sh脚本中输入执行命令即可,跟在linux环境下没有什么两样: 加上“python”是具有软连接的; python filename.py 2&…
2025/1/29 22:37:28 人评论 次浏览1.使用new构造方法 创建新的对象 2.构造方法是定义在java类中的一个用来初始化对象的方法 构造方法与类同名且没有返回值 静态变量应使用 static 关键字修饰 可以通过 “类名.静态变量” 访问静态变量 如:HelloWorld.className 也可以通过 “对象名.静态变量” 访…
2025/1/29 22:36:57 人评论 次浏览根据关键字镜像搜索# docker search 服务关键字docker search mysql镜像搜索拉取镜像# docker pull 镜像NAME:版本docker pull mysqldocker pull mysql:5.7查看本地镜像列表docker images启动容器// 启动docker run --name mysql //--name 指定容器名称-p 3306:3306 //-p 指定…
2025/1/29 22:35:57 人评论 次浏览